Digital Storm Unveils VELOX Midsized Gaming PC
Digital Storm recently unveiled the VELOX enthusiast-level gaming PC. The system uses a custom chassis designed to showcase components and maximize airflow. The VELOX is a mid-sized system designed to sit between the small form factor BOLT II and the huge AVENTUM II PCs. Like the other models, the VELOX features forged steel and exotic cooling elements that are standard on Digital Storm PCs, as well as vented panels designed to maximize airflow. Review: Cooler Master CM Storm QuickFire XT Stealth (MX Green)
Today we are taking a look at the Cooler Master (CM) Storm QuickFire XT Stealth mechanical keyboard (with Cherry MX Green switches). The QuickFire XT is the full size variant of the QuickFire series, and the Stealth denotes the fact that it has front-printed keys (as opposed to top-printed). We previously reviewed the QuickFire TK as well as the QuickFire Stealth. Since the QuickFire XT Stealth is basically just a full sized version of the QuickFire Stealth, we’re going to focus primarily on the differences between the models, as well as our experience using Cherry MX Green switches.
